Israeli forces on Thursday killed 35 more Palestinians, including four individuals waiting to receive humanitarian aid, rescue workers in Gaza confirmed.
Mahmud Bassal, spokesperson for the Gaza Civil Defence agency, told AFP that 35 people were killed by Israeli fire in various locations throughout the Gaza Strip.
They included "four who were waiting for humanitarian aid," he added. The military did not immediately respond to an AFP request for comment, saying it required further information.
A medical source told Anadolu that four people were killed and many others injured in a strike targeting a home in Jabalia town in northern Gaza.
Three others were killed when a drone shelled a group of civilians in the Zaytoun neighborhood of southern Gaza City, he added. Another civilian was transferred to al-Ahli Baptist Hospital due to his critical condition.
